A Soare <alinsoar@voila.fr> writes:

>> I believe it was fixed by this change, but it would be nice
>> if A Soare would verify that it does.
>> 
>> 2007-03-10  Kim F. Storm  <storm@cua.dk>
>> 
>> 	* xdisp.c (redisplay_window): Don't automatically select a new window
>> 	start for a contination line during mouse-click.
>> 
>
> I cheched, and selection is ok. But the cursor position is wrong.
>
> When I am at the middle of the line of the output syntax, and I
> press left button, the cursor jumps on the column where it has to
> jump, but the cursor's line is wrong.

The cursor may seems to end up on the wrong line, but it should be
placed on the BUFFER POSITION where you clicked with the mouse.

This is because the screen may scroll a few lines as a result of the
click in such a line, so it just looks wrong.

Please double check!


That scrolling is very hard to get rid of -- so that's for after the
release.
